What is the Difference between konark psc cement and konark ppc cement?

A brief description along with comparison of konark psc (Portland Slag cement) cement and konark ppc (Portland Pozzolana cement) cement are discussed below: ·        Konark psc cement: It is popularly known as Portland Slag Cement. It is manufactured by grinding together with “Portland cement clinker”, “Blust furnace granulated slag” as well as gypsum. Sometimes, it is also manufactured by mixing or combining with ordinary Portland cement or opc cement along with “ground granulated furnace slag” through mechanical mixers or proper blenders. It is also made up of 45-50% of clinker and 3 to 5% of gypsum. This type of cement is eco-friendly. The konark psc cement is used in the construction of marine structures. It is commonly used in the coastal areas especially where immoderate amount of sulphates and chloride salts are found. It is known to provide resistance towards sulphates and chlorides attack.
